Family Bond
Onias Mupumha

Cobalt Stone

58cm (h)
111cm (w)
19cm (d)

60kg

SOLD

The fluid, organic lines of this beautiful sculpture are typical of Onias' award-winning work.

As a special request, Onias created a widely-branching shape with a substantial and solid base. This piece has a wonderful balance and roundedness that contrasts with some of his more willowy tall pieces.

Cobalt stone is the local Zimbabwean name given to this purple and green type of serpentine. It does not, as far as we know, contain any cobalt but it may originally have been found near a cobalt mine. Nowadays, it is mined near Chiweshe, in northern Zimbabwe.
